10836971627 has 2 divisors, whose sum is σ = 10836971628. Its totient is φ = 10836971626.
The previous prime is 10836971581. The next prime is 10836971659. The reversal of 10836971627 is 72617963801.
10836971627 is digitally balanced in base 2, because in such base it contains all the possibile digits an equal number of times.
It is a strong prime.
It is an emirp because it is prime and its reverse (72617963801) is a distict prime.
It is a cyclic number.
It is not a de Polignac number, because 10836971627 - 214 = 10836955243 is a prime.
It is not a weakly prime, because it can be changed into another prime (10836971027) by changing a digit.
It is a pernicious number, because its binary representation contains a prime number (17) of ones.
It is a polite number, since it can be written as a sum of consecutive naturals, namely, 5418485813 + 5418485814.
It is an arithmetic number, because the mean of its divisors is an integer number (5418485814).
Almost surely, 210836971627 is an apocalyptic number.
10836971627 is a deficient number, since it is larger than the sum of its proper divisors (1).
10836971627 is an equidigital number, since it uses as much as digits as its factorization.
10836971627 is an odious number, because the sum of its binary digits is odd.
The product of its (nonzero) digits is 762048, while the sum is 50.
The spelling of 10836971627 in words is "ten billion, eight hundred thirty-six million, nine hundred seventy-one thousand, six hundred twenty-seven".
